#18I don't understand the water argument? I thought places like data centers would use something akin a closed loop and a radiator. Are they taking water from the town pipe, heating it once, and then launching it into the sun? Is there some other use for the water other than cooling?
A large portion of data centers use open loop cooling. That is to say evaporative cooling. So they take fresh drinking water, make it hot, and dump it in the air. It's a lot cheaper than closed loop cooling.
Particularly, newer data centers are much more likely to used closed loop systems. And, the bigger they are, the more likely they're on closed loop.
